Title: The Rise of Dawn of the Planet of the Apes (2014)

Released in 2014, “Dawn of the Planet of the Apes” marks a groundbreaking chapter in the iconic Planet of the Apes franchise. Directed by Matt Reeves, this sequel to the 2011 film “Rise of the Planet of the Apes” continues the story of Caesar, a highly intelligent genetically evolved chimpanzee leading his fellow apes in a fight for survival against humans.

Set a decade after the events of the first film, “Dawn of the Planet of the Apes” delves deeper into the conflict between humans and apes. The film portrays a world where the human population has been decimated by a deadly virus, while the apes have flourished and established their own society in the Muir Woods. Caesar, portrayed by Andy Serkis through motion-capture technology, must navigate the complexities of leadership as he strives to protect his kind from both external threats and internal power struggles.

One of the standout aspects of “Dawn of the Planet of the Apes” is its seamless blend of cutting-edge visual effects and emotionally resonant storytelling. The film showcases the evolution of motion-capture technology, allowing for incredibly lifelike portrayals of the ape characters. This realism serves to enhance the audience’s connection to the plight of the apes and the moral dilemmas they face in their interactions with humans.

The themes explored in “Dawn of the Planet of the Apes” go beyond standard sci-fi fare, touching on profound topics such as empathy, loyalty, and the consequences of unchecked ambition. Through the lens of the conflict between humans and apes, the film prompts viewers to reflect on the nature of power, the importance of understanding and communication, and the potential for both cooperation and conflict in a diverse world.

In addition to its engaging narrative and technical achievements, “Dawn of the Planet of the Apes” features strong performances from its cast, including Jason Clarke, Gary Oldman, and Keri Russell. The film’s compelling characters and dynamic interactions serve to elevate the storytelling and create a sense of urgency and emotional depth throughout.

Overall, “Dawn of the Planet of the Apes” stands as a testament to the power of storytelling and visual innovation in modern cinema. By combining groundbreaking technology with a gripping narrative, the film captivates audiences and invites them to ponder the complex dynamics of a world in which humanity is faced with its own creation.
